View from the Dolman Posted May 30, 2018 Report Share Posted May 30, 2018 Land owned by Esteban Investments based on the Land Registry's open data.... Title Number: AV106717 - Cumberland House, Marsh Road, Bristol - price paid: £2,600,000 03/03/2014 Title Number: AV6615 - Ashton Works, Winterstoke Road, Bristol - price paid: £6,825,000 16/09/2015 Title Number: AV105479 - land and buildings on the South East side of Marsh Road, Ashton, Bristol - price paid: not stated 10/03/2016 Title Number: AV67007 - Midas House, Winterstoke Road, Bristol - price paid: £2,000,000 06/04/2017 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Dave L Posted May 30, 2018 Report Share Posted May 30, 2018 There will be two stops nearer than the P & R. One is just the other side of the railway tracks behind the Ford garage, as the flyover finishes. The other one is behind the block of flats where the bowling place used to be. From there it's a short walk across Greville Smyth park. This route will open in the Autumn following some last minute tweaks to the infrastructure over the summer. It remains to be seen what impact Metrobus will have on accessing AG by public transport. If they run enough buses at the right time, it could really help those people coming from the centre or the North of the City.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
